Latest Patents
Among Wolfgang Schneider's notable inventions are two groundbreaking patents. The first is a **Mold with a Function Ring**, aimed at enhancing the design of a hot-top mold for a strand casting apparatus. This invention features a hot-top that presses against a parting agent distributor, while an overhang is formed on the radially inner surface, ensuring effective separation during the casting process. Additionally, the mold is designed to have adjustable roughness on surfaces, contributing to improved functionality in metal casting.
The second patent, **Continuous Casting Apparatus**, innovates a starter bar design that addresses common challenges like deformation of the billet base and loss of casting metal. It features a tub-like structure with tapered outer surfaces to stabilize the billet during casting, thereby enhancing productivity and minimizing waste.
